    HDFC Bank Limited. HDFC Bank Limited (also known as HDFC) is an Indian banking and financial services company headquartered in Mumbai. It is India's largest private sector bank by assets and the world's tenth-largest bank by market capitalization as of May 2024.

    Yes Bank Limited is an Indian private sector bank founded by Rana Kapoor and Ashok Kapoor in 2005. It is a full-service commercial bank headquartered in Mumbai, trading through its 1,198 branches, 193 BCBOs, and over 1,287 ATMs (including CRMs and BNAs) across more than 300 districts in India, catering to retail, MSME, and corporate clients.

Bandhan Bank Ltd. is a banking and financial services company, headquartered in Kolkata. Bandhan Bank is present in 35 out of 36 states and union territories of India, with 6,297 banking outlets and 3.36 crore customers.

    RBL Bank, formerly known as Ratnakar Bank Limited, is an Indian private sector bank founded in 1943; its headquarters are in Mumbai.It offers services across six verticals: corporate and institutional banking, commercial banking, branch and business banking, retail assets, development banking and financial inclusion, treasury and financial market operations.
